Use a programme like reason, cubase or acid etc. all are good depending on the depth you want to get into in your tune (how good it is) i would reccommend acid as you can rly get into depth on a tune but it can be tricky to begin with.

When you have made your tune and are satisfied with it, send it round to some mates and Dj's to get thier view of it, if the majority give you good feedback then they think your tune is good, keep looking for little bits to tweak and change to make it sound even better then try and get it pressed onto vinyl by a producer Razz you can then play it on decks
